The aviation industry remains a dynamic and vital sector, characterized by continuous improvements in efficiency and evolving consumer demands. Airlines operating in this competitive space rely on high-frequency operations and extensive route networks to serve a broad customer base. Ryanair Holdings PLC (LSE:RYA) is a leading figure in the low-cost carrier segment across Europe. The company leverages streamlined operations and cost-efficient strategies to maintain a prominent position in the market.

Record Passenger Volumes and Operational Efficiency
Ryanair Holdings PLC recently reported remarkable passenger volumes, setting a new benchmark within the European aviation landscape. The airline achieved a milestone by transporting a vast number of travelers over the course of a year. Regular operations have seen a robust performance during key travel periods, with heavy traffic observed in peak months. This operational achievement underscores the airline’s ability to efficiently manage high flight frequencies and extensive route networks. Consistently high load factors remain a critical indicator of operational success and efficient resource utilization.
